I'm so thankful for Kenny Welch of Kenny's Rod Shop for helping me for the last 2 weekends get the exhaust looking real nice. So awesome to be around dudes with this level of talent.
On Kenny's advice.... Though I did buy a Borla Universal kit, he likes to use sanitary pipe elbows from an industrial piping supply house. Super clean way to have perfect flat surfaces at exactly the right angle. So, I didn't need the Borla kit but I'll find a good home for it - lesson...ask the experts before ordering! When the dust settles, I think the cost of those pieces and a couple straight sections is less than the Universal kit but the fit is sooo tight! Highly recommend!
